Nuclear Systems Engineering and Design

Credit: 3 hours.

Engineering principles underlying nuclear power plant components and systems will be covered. Specifically, focus in this course will be on energy generation, heat conduction, single- and two-phase flows, and on energy removal in single- and two-phase flows. Equal emphasis will be placed on component and system level treatment, as well as on both the underlying theory and its applications to practical design and maintenance problems encountered in the field of nuclear engineering.

3 undergraduate hours. 3 graduate hours. Prerequisite: NPRE 349, NPRE 455.
